1. A cellular communications system comprising:

  • at least one node positioned so to establish a set of cells, each node including means for transmitting and receiving different predetermined sets of code division multiple access coded, digitally modulated spread spectrum waveforms;

    a plurality of user units within the cells, each user unit including means for communicating with at least one of said nodes and being operatively responsive to a predetermined one of the sets of code division multiple access coded waveforms to thereby establish selective communication with at least one of said nodes; and

    position determination means for determining the position of a selected user unit by providing a timing signal carried by one of the sets of code division multiple access coded waveforms to the user unit from one or more nodes, providing a timing response signal carried by one of the sets of code division multiple access coded waveforms from the selected user unit in response to each timing signal, receiving the timing response signal by at least one node, measuring the response time of the user unit to each timing signal, and determining the position of the user unit based on such measurements.
